Dozens of celebrities and A-listers took to New York as the annual Met Gala (or Met Ball if you please) took place. This particular gathering, a fundraising gala for the Metropolitan's Museum of Art's Costume Institute, is the event of season for the East Coast.

Anna Wintour, "Vogue" editor-in-chief and real-life Miranda Priestly, oversees the event with her staff all over the scene. This year seemed particular star-studded as potential drama lay all over the red carpet, and inside, too.
